Lambodhara to use DR Spinning's yarn making capacity

15 Jun '16
1 min read

Indian fancy yarn maker Lambodhara Textiles will be using the spinning capacity of DR Spinning Mills to manufacture yarn from fibres, according to a company filing with the BSE.

DR Spinning Mills' spare capacity of 5,456 spindles will be used for converting fibre into yarn.

Lambodhara Textiles currently has 37,856 spindles, out of which 33,224 spindles are used for producing fancy yarns.

This agreement will benefit the overall performance of the company by increasing its spinning capacity. (MCJ)
